Events Calendar Pro
Fixes
- Change myremove to jQuery Grep to improve compatibility with Black Studio TinyMCE Widget (Thank you @digisavvy for reporting this in the support Forums)
- Add check for past events in the mini calendar and event list widget date icon box so it shows the correct information (Initially reported by @yuryvasilchenko in the support forums. Thanks!)
Fixes
- Issue that could lead to the generation of infinite recurring events (props to hydeaway and many others)
Fixes
- Broken oembedding of content
- Recurring event instances happening on the same day are now assigned different post names and guids
Tweaks
- Avoid loading customizer preview scripts when not previewing site in Theme Customizer
Fixes
- Fix issue where width of content area in photo view was inheriting styles making it too narrow
- Allow '0' to be set as the value of additional fields
- Graciously handle malformed recurrence event meta information
- Fixed an issue where 'All Day' label was displaying on Wednesday rather than the time column
Tweaks
- Added helper text near Distance filter to add clarity for Filter Bar users
Tweaks
- Advanced List Widget shows the month instead of the day of the week in the date icon when the event is not in the current month
- Improved our JSON-LD output to ensure consistency (Props to @garrettjohnson!)
- Language files in the
wp-content/languages/pluginspath will be loaded before attempting to load internal language files (Thank you to user @aafhhl for bringing this to our attention!) - Move plugin CSS to PostCSS
Fixes
- Tooltip not was not rendering properly for date recurrence (Thank you @Maciej for reporting this issue!)
Tweaks
- Restored section heading for Additional Fields
Fixes
- Resolved minor incompatibilities with the Safari browser
- Fixed issue where legacy recurrence description fields were not migrated to the new recurrence data structure introduced in 3.12 (props to publiclife on the forums for reporting this!)
Tweaks
- Changed the word "Once" in an event's recurring settings because it was pretty confusing for everyone, including us
Security
- Tightened up security around AJAX calls (props to James Golovich for reporting the problem!)
Tweaks
- Change This Widget Widget query filter to a unique name
Fixes
- Resolved issue where the week view was always using UTC rather than the configured timezone when determining the start of the week (props to paulhazon in our forums for pointing out this issue!)
- Fixed bug where the first event in a recurring series would not render the start or end times (props to laughmasters for reporting this bug!)
- Resolved various capitalization issues with German translations (props to oheinrich in our forums for pointing out this issue!)
- Fixed issue where some Theme Customizer headings were not translatable (props to oheinrich in our forums for pointing out this issue as well!)
Features
- Added a new "Date" recurrence rule that allows you to set an event to recur on a single (or any number of) individually specified dates (hat-tip to @tonydemarco for the idea!)
Tweaks
- Added support for manual timezone offsets in recurrence exclusion rules
- Improved the support of selected query fields when the "Recurring event instances" checkbox in Events > Settings is checked
- Show an error message when the Google Maps API query limit has been reached
- Improved the handling of addresses in JSON-LD
- Removed deprecated sensor get var for Google Maps API endpoint
- Changed the distance unit label in Settings to be less-specific to maps as it is used elsewhere
- Improved the structure of hierarchical taxonomy terms in List Widget queries (props to Harvard Law for this pull request!)
- Simplified the APM Venue and Organizer filters when the Events list is loaded (props to Jake Kantzer for the pull request!)
Fixes
- Fixed invalid class name when throwing Tribe notices in the Map template
- Resolved issue where the Map View slug was not translatable (three cheers for @oheinrich giving us a heads up on this!)
- Fixed bug where the wrong class was referenced when setting notices in Map View
- Improved compatibility with ACF on the Edit Event page
Fixes
- Load venue shortcode when there are no Events on that venue
- Default value for
tribe_get_event_website_link_targetis corrected to_self - Default values for Venue and Organizers are now fully respected across the add-ons
